Abstract

The invention belongs to the technical field of digitalized analysis, and discloses a digitalized analysis feedback method for village travel information, which comprises the following steps of S100, obtaining photos of tourists and scenic spots; s101, obtaining photo information, wherein the photo information comprises photographing place data; s102, importing the shooting place data into a scenic spot map, associating the photo corresponding to the place data with the position in the scenic spot map, generating mark information at the position corresponding to the place in the scenic spot map, and clicking the mark information to display the photo; s103, comparing and analyzing the number of the photos contained in the marking information with a set threshold value, and judging whether prompt information is generated or not; according to the feedback method, the number of times that the tourists recognize different places is obtained, the tourists can fully know the favorite of the tourists from the perspective of the tourists through analyzing data, undeveloped scenic spots are collected and developed, the tourists like the scenic spots are increased, the viscosity of the tourists is increased, unnecessary scenic spot development is reduced, and the construction cost of rural tourism is reduced.

Technical Field
The invention relates to the technical field of digitalized analysis, in particular to a system and a method for digitalized analysis and feedback of rural tourism information.
Background
The rural tourism source is mostly urban tourists, the purpose of tourism on the rural area is mainly to appreciate the natural landscape of the rural area, and how to increase the viscosity of the tourists is very important in the tourism market facing increasingly competitive.
In the development of tourist attractions, do not accomplish to fully understand behind the real hobby of most tourists, develop the sight again, lead to the sight of rural area tourism development, can not received by most tourists, when increasing development cost, also can lead to the visitor viscidity poor, be unfavorable for the long-term development in scenic spot. How to obtain the preferences of the tourists is of great importance, most of the traditional obtaining methods are surveys in the form of filling out an opinion book or a street questionnaire, the efficiency is low, more answers are derived, and the real preferences of the tourists cannot be really known.

Examples
Referring to fig. 1, the embodiment of the invention discloses a method for analyzing and feeding back the rural tourism information in a datamation manner, which comprises the following steps,
s100, obtaining photos of the tourist and the scenic spots, namely the photo of the tourist and the scenic spots.
S101, photo information is obtained, wherein the photo information comprises photo taking place data, and the photo taking place is contained in exif information in the photo.
S102, importing the shooting location data into a scenic spot map (the scenic spot map is a scenic spot electronic map, preferably a 3D scenic spot map), associating the photo corresponding to the location data with a position in the scenic spot map, generating mark information at the position in the scenic spot map corresponding to the location, and displaying the photo by clicking the mark information, wherein the photo is uploaded by the visitor.
S103, comparing and analyzing the number of the photos contained in the marking information with a set threshold value, and judging whether prompt information is generated or not.
The specific judgment method is as follows:
if the number of the photos contained in the marking information is smaller than the set threshold value, no prompt receiving and recording information is generated;
and if the number of the photos contained in the marking information is greater than or equal to the threshold value, matching the position corresponding to the photo from the scenery spot recording database, if the matching result is greater than 1 and the number 1 represents the number of the matching result, indicating that the position is in the scenery spot recording database, not generating the prompt information, and if the matching result is 0, indicating that the position is not in the scenery spot recording database, generating the prompt information.
The prompt information comprises the number of times that the site is approved by the tourists, the number of times that the site is approved by the tourists is generated according to the photos contained in the mark information corresponding to the site, the number of faces can be obtained through the picture face recognition software, and the number of times that the site is approved by the tourists is equal to the sum of the number of faces in all the photos in the mark information. And providing a matched analysis data base for a country tourism manager to determine whether to develop the undeveloped sceneries where the place is located. From the perspective of the tourists, the most real hobby of the tourists is fully known through analyzing data, undeveloped scenic spots are subjected to recording, development, management and maintenance, the number of scenic spots favored by the tourists is increased, the viscosity of the tourists is increased, unnecessary scenic spot development is reduced, and the tourism construction cost of the village is reduced.
Referring to fig. 2, in the embodiment, the mode of providing photos by the guest is as follows, when the communication base station in the scenic spot is accessed to the guest mobile device for communication to the network, mobile information is sent to the mobile device, where the mobile information includes welcome words, a photo uploading mode, and rewards for participating in photo uploading, and the photo uploading mode is, for example, two-dimensional codes, links, public numbers of interest, or short mobile video accounts. The mobile information is edited by a country tourism manager in advance, permission is obtained from a scenic spot communication base station operator, and the edited mobile information is sent to the communication base station operator to be checked and passed.
In this embodiment, a photo uploading manner is taken as an example of the link.
In order to fully utilize and analyze photos of tourists, after the photos of the tourists and scenic spots are obtained, when photo information is obtained, if the mobile equipment of the tourists closes the positioning information, the shooting places of the photos cannot be obtained, the photos of the shooting positions which cannot be obtained are independently stored, assistance information is produced, the assistance information at least comprises a storage path of the photos of the shooting positions which cannot be obtained, the storage path is identified by scenic spot workers, the photos of the shooting positions which cannot be obtained are associated with the positions in a scenic spot map, and each piece of tourist feedback information is fully utilized.
In order to further improve the efficiency of the data analysis, when the tourists upload the photos, the photos which are uploaded repeatedly may exist, and after the photos are obtained, the photos are removed in duplicate, and the data analysis can be realized through the photo duplicate removal software.
Referring to fig. 3, in order to quickly honor the promise of the tourist, when the photo of the tourist is obtained, the contact information of the tourist is also obtained, and when the photo is uploaded by the tourist, the contact information is simultaneously filled in, in this embodiment, the contact information is, for example, a mobile device phone number, and the exchange information is sent to the contact information, where the exchange information at least includes an exchange place, the tourist can exchange according to the exchange place, and the exchange place can be set in a place with a large traffic volume, so that more tourists can be attracted to participate, and basic data is provided for the rural tourism information data analysis in this embodiment.
In order to further optimize the technical scheme, risk assessment is carried out on the surrounding environment displayed by the photos contained in the marking information, and first assessment information is generated; the risk assessment content includes determining whether a risk factor exists at the photo taking place, for example, some visitors like a hunter, the selected photo taking place is beside a cliff, or for scenery formation, positions beside a river, high above a river, etc. are selected, and when the photo is taken, the photographer often ignores the feet, which results in the occurrence of a safety accident, and the first assessment information includes measures for eliminating the risk factor, that is, the first assessment information includes whether a protective facility, a safety warning sign, or a caution item is added to the photo taking place at the photo taking place, and the protective facility, such as a guardrail, includes measures for eliminating the risk factor. Starting from the visual angle of the tourist, the improvement of related safety facilities is strengthened for scenic spots interested by the tourist, and the safety of the tourist is guaranteed by starting from the requirement of the tourist.
In order to further optimize the technical scheme, the landscape scene displayed by the photos contained in the marking information is optimized and evaluated to generate second evaluation information; optimizing the assessment content includes assessing green plants, trees, buildings or other factors that can affect the beauty of the photo, i.e., optimizing the assessment content includes determining whether there are factors that affect the beauty of the photo; the second evaluation information includes whether the landscape scene shown by the photo is optimized, and the optimized content includes factors existing in the optimized evaluation content, namely the second evaluation information includes factors existing in processing the optimized evaluation content. And the second evaluation information is evaluated by a landscape designer on the landscape scene displayed by the photo, and the feedback suggestion is given to continuously optimize the country scenic spots, improve the attractiveness of the scenic spots displayed in the photo, improve the card punching rate of tourists and provide an increase point for the development of the country tourism.
